Wendell Carter Jr. tag page compiles news articles, game reports, interviews, and updates covering the NBA career of the American basketball player. Coverage spans his selection as the seventh overall pick in the 2018 NBA Draft by the Chicago Bulls, his three seasons in Chicago, and his transition to the Orlando Magic in 2021. Reports include his four-year rookie extension, career-high 30-point performances, and his October 2024 three-year, $58.7 million contract extension. Articles also reference his lone season at Duke, where he averaged 13.1 points and 9.1 rebounds, along with his achievements as a McDonald’s All-American and Morgan Wootten National Player of the Year. The tag tracks his role as a versatile center and power forward contributing to Orlando’s Eastern Conference efforts.
